Skip to content
Mr Ceviche Peruvian Restaurant

Mr Ceviche Peruvian Restaurant

4.5 xStar (460+)2265.9 kmPeruvianSeafoodChickenInfo

x Delivered by store staff

xDelivery bag remove Delivery unavailable

2001 Biscayne Blvd, Miami, FL 33137, USA